Output 88368226262c80c3f8a6d11e4cce152b2ac5ef58e9e16348af059d98c23b038a:18

value
184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5ffa959400b0dddc3426178b45e00a7d09cb1a OP_EQUAL
address
38k8w3NhQhKsZBBVSTnjAMWToGXACv5Xqe
transaction
88368226262c80c3f8a6d11e4cce152b2ac5ef58e9e16348af059d98c23b038a
spent
true